    • Methods, systems, apparatus including computer program products having instructions for porting numbers are provided. In one example system and method, a vPBX system can receive a request from a user to port an existing phone number to the vPBX system. The vPBX server can identify a porting authentication template, based on the requirements of an existing service provider. The vPBX server generate a fax document on the retrieved template. The vPBX server can populate the generated fax document with user information. The vPBX server can receive a user's hand signature from a touch-screen interface of a mobile device. The vPBX server can authenticate the fax document with the received signature, and transmit the authenticated fax document to the existing service provider. The vPBX server can provide the user with a temporary line number with forwarding functions until porting is completed.

    • System, apparatus, computer program products and methods for preventing fraud attacks (e.g., on a virtual PBX service provider) are disclosed. In some implementations, a set of fraud evaluation processes are performed, an overall fraud evaluation score is incremented as each of the set of fraud evaluation processes are performed and a step result is obtained. A user request (e.g., account activation) can be denied or accepted based on the overall fraud evaluation score. In some implementations, the set of fraud evaluation processes can include one or more of: an internal fraud evaluation process, a process for checking multiple trial accounts associated with a common account parameter, a process for geolocation verification of multiple account parameters, a process for device type verification for a contact phone number, a process for credit card verification, and a process for placing a contact number verification call.

    • Systems, methods and computer program products for enabling integration between various internet- or non-internet based communication services (e.g., as provided by different communications platforms and service providers) using a universal platform are described. In some implementations, a service manager is provided that can integrate call management capabilities with multiple communications platforms using the universal platform to enable seamless communication between the various platforms. For example, interactions between individual users on one or more platforms can be tracked in a single conversation history as a threaded interface. The universal platform can integrate with various platforms and third party protocols and services to provide call features that include, for example, call forwarding, call handling, multiple greeting prompts, call screening rules, ring-out rules, international calling, caller ID rules, after hours, and announcement prompts.

    • System and methods for providing telecommunication functions on a mobile device are disclosed. An inbound call request is received, a call control interface is presented for a user to choose among a plurality of communication modes by which an inbound call is to be established. Call control data selecting a mode of communication is received through the call control interface. Communication is established according to the selected mode of communication. An outbound call request identifying a callee device is send from a mobile device through a packet network to a telecommunication service provider, and a call connection from the mobile device to the telecommunication service provider is established through the telecom network. The telecommunication service provider places a call to the callee device and combines the call connection from the mobile device to the connection to the callee device to establish a single joint call connection.
